The French Library / Alliance Française of Boston & Cambridge is a nonprofit organization based in Boston, Massachusetts, that provides affordable access to language education and cultural programming for the general public. It operates the largest private collection of French books, periodicals, and DVDs in the United States and runs a school affiliated with the Alliance Française network, offering language classes for adults and children. While French culture remains the historical focus, the organization actively promotes the discovery and appreciation of other cultures through its programming. The organization serves a diverse community including children, teens, and adults, and many programs are conducted in English to ensure accessibility even for non-French speakers. Its cultural offerings include lectures, concerts, cooking demonstrations, wine tastings, art exhibitions, and holiday celebrations, reflecting a broad Francophone cultural agenda. In January 2026, the organization announced the launch of an English-language collection.
